Understanding Estate Planning Basics in Leawood, KS
In Leawood, KS, understanding estate planning basics is a crucial step towards securing your family’s future. Estate planning involves creating legal documents that direct how your assets will be distributed after your death and ensure your wishes are respected. A comprehensive plan also addresses end-of-life care, including healthcare decisions and preferences for medical treatment—a vital aspect of compassionate elderly care planning in our community. One of the primary considerations is managing estate taxes, which can significantly impact your beneficiaries’ inheritances. An informed strategy involves utilizing tax-efficient vehicles like trusts and life insurance policies. For instance, a well-structured revocable living trust can help avoid probate, reducing potential delays and legal costs. Beyond asset distribution and tax management, a robust estate plan includes power of attorney designations, advance healthcare directives (living wills), and beneficiary designations for retirement accounts and insurance policies. These documents empower your chosen representatives to act in your best interest should you become incapacitated, while also providing clear guidance on end-of-life care preferences. One of the critical aspects to consider is naming guardians for minor children and pets. This decision goes beyond mere legal formality; it involves ensuring their well-being in your absence. Estate planning lawyer Leawood KS professionals can assist in drafting guidelines and appointments that reflect your wishes, providing clarity during emotionally charged times. Additionally, establishing trusts can offer significant advantages in asset protection and tax efficiency. Revocable living trusts, for instance, allow you to retain control over your assets while also ensuring they are managed according to your instructions should you become incapacitated.
